SEMA Show, Day Two: DSP offers workshop

Nov. 6, 2013

For the second year, Dealer Strategic Planning Inc. (DSP) offered a one-day budget workshop for its 20 Group members during the Specialty Equipment Market Association (SEMA) Show week in Las Vegas. 

Twenty members attended this year’s workshop. (20 Group members are tire and automotive service dealers who meet three times a year to share best practices and benchmark against the industry to improve financial performance.)  

At the workshop, each 20 Group member is supplied with a history of their detailed 2013 income statement by month on a simple excel flash-drive worksheet. The dealer can view the history and make decisions about upcoming influences on his/her business for the coming year. Without business distractions taking focus away from preparing a budget, the business owner finishes the day with his business plan complete for 2014.

“The budget workshop is just one of the values realized by being a 20 Group member,” says Norm Gaither, DSP owner. “Without a business plan, it’s like going on a trip without a map. This is one of the most important essentials of running a successful business and too many owners don’t take the time to work ‘on’ their business instead of ‘in’ their business. The popularity of this workshop has grown tremendously and we expect to continue this offering to our members for years to come.”
